Westinghouse's response to the need for simpler reactors that produce power more cheaply and improve public confidence in their safety is the AP600, an advanced passive PWR. The AP600 is based on Westinghouse's two loop PWR, but the design has been simplified considerably. The operating systems are simpler, and safety systems rely predominantly on gravity, convection and natural circulation. The simplified systems increase availability and reduce equipment and seismic building volume, reducing capital costs and construction time. The passive core cooling and passive containment cooling systems (PCCS) are the keystones on which the design is built. The first level of defence - proven conventional systems - is backed up by passive safety systems that protect the plant even in remote cases where operator actions are not possible or not appropriate. Westinghouse has submitted the Standard Safety Analysis Report on AP600 to the US Nuclear Regulatory Commission (NRC). The report is supported by a series of tests aimed at confirming the design's passive cooling capability which is described in this article. (author)
